This guide explains who qualifies for the Amazon RDS Free Tier, what’s included, what isn’t, and how to avoid unexpected charges as your database usage grows.
Which AWS RDS Free Tier Applies to You?
| AWS account | Amazon RDS Free Tier |
|---|---|
| Created before July 15, 2025 | Traditional 12-month Free Tier with monthly usage allowances for eligible Amazon RDS resources. |
| Created on or after July 15, 2025 | Choose between a Free account plan and Paid account plan, both of which include promotional AWS credits for eligible AWS services, including Amazon RDS. |
For newer AWS accounts, eligible Amazon RDS charges consume promotional AWS credits instead of monthly resource allowances.
Before launching an Amazon RDS instance, verify which Free Tier model applies to your account and review the latest AWS Free Tier documentation. Review the latest AWS Free Tier page.
What Does the Amazon RDS Free Tier Include?
Regardless of the model, only eligible Amazon RDS resources qualify. Unsupported configurations or usage beyond the applicable limits are billed at standard Amazon RDS pricing.
For AWS accounts created before July 15, 2025, the traditional Amazon RDS Free Tier includes the following monthly benefits for the first 12 months after account creation:
| Resource | Free Tier allowance |
|---|---|
| DB instance usage | Up to 750 hours of eligible micro DB instance usage per month |
| Database storage | Up to 20 GB of General Purpose SSD (gp2) storage |
| Automated backup storage | Up to 20 GB of automated backup storage |
For AWS accounts created on or after July 15, 2025, eligible Amazon RDS usage consumes promotional AWS credits instead of monthly resource allowances. The amount of free usage depends on your database configuration, AWS Region, and remaining promotional credit balance.

Which Amazon RDS Database Engines Are Eligible?
- MySQL
- PostgreSQL
- MariaDB
- Microsoft SQL Server Express Edition
Always review the latest Amazon RDS pricing and AWS Free Tier documentation before launching a database, as supported engines and Free Tier benefits may change over time.
Does the Free Tier Cover Multiple Databases?
For example, under the traditional 12-month Free Tier, the 750 instance hours per month are shared across all eligible Amazon RDS instances.
- Running one eligible DB instance continuously for a month generally stays within the allowance.
- Running multiple eligible instances at the same time consumes the shared limit more quickly.
What Isn't Included in the Amazon RDS Free Tier?
The traditional 12-month Amazon RDS Free Tier covers only eligible DB instances, storage, and automated backups within the monthly limits. Features outside these allowances are billed separately.
For accounts created on or after July 15, 2025, eligible charges for these features may be offset using promotional AWS credits while credits remain available, subject to AWS’s current Free Tier terms.
| Feature | Traditional 12-month Free Tier | Free account plan / Paid account plan |
|---|---|---|
| Multi-AZ deployments | Not included | Eligible charges may consume promotional AWS credits |
| Amazon Aurora | Not included | Eligible Aurora usage may consume promotional AWS credits |
| Read Replicas | Not included | Eligible charges may consume promotional AWS credits |
| Provisioned IOPS (io1/io2) storage | Not included | Eligible charges may consume promotional AWS credits |
| Storage beyond included limits | Not included | Eligible charges may consume promotional AWS credits |
| Backup storage beyond the no-charge allowance | Not included | Eligible charges may consume promotional AWS credits |
| RDS Proxy | Not included | Eligible charges may consume promotional AWS credits |
| Public IPv4 addresses | Not included | Standard public IPv4 charges apply where applicable |
| Cross-Region snapshot copies | Not included | Eligible charges may consume promotional AWS credits |
How Amazon RDS Free Tier Billing Works
For AWS accounts created before July 15, 2025, AWS applies the traditional 12-month Free Tier by tracking eligible DB instance hours, storage, and automated backup usage against the monthly Free Tier limits. Usage beyond those limits is billed at the standard Amazon RDS rates.
For AWS accounts created on or after July 15, 2025, eligible Amazon RDS charges consume promotional AWS credits instead of fixed monthly resource allowances. Charges are billed at standard Amazon RDS rates only after promotional credits are no longer available or no longer apply.
Example: Shared Usage Under the Traditional Free Tier
| Resource | Usage | Free Tier status |
|---|---|---|
| DB Instance 1 | Runs continuously for the month | Covered within the 750-hour monthly allowance |
| DB Instance 2 | Runs continuously alongside DB Instance 1 | Combined usage exceeds 750 hours, resulting in billable compute |
| Database storage | 18 GB (gp2) | Covered under the 20 GB allowance |
| Automated backups | 12 GB | Covered under the applicable Free Tier allowance |
What Happens After the Amazon RDS Free Tier Ends?
- Traditional 12-month Free Tier: Eligible Amazon RDS resources continue running and are billed at the standard On-Demand rates unless you stop or delete them.
- Free account plan: The plan ends when six months have passed since account creation or your promotional credits are exhausted, whichever comes first. To continue using AWS services, you must upgrade to a Paid account plan. Any remaining eligible promotional credits may continue to apply until their stated expiration date.
Amazon RDS Free Tier Exit Checklist
| Review area | Why it matters |
|---|---|
| DB instance size | Ensure the selected instance class still matches your workload. |
| Storage utilization | Remove unused data and review storage growth before paying for additional capacity. |
| Deployment type | Confirm whether your workload really requires Multi-AZ or other production features. |
| Backup retention & snapshots | Retained backups and manual snapshots continue to consume storage and may incur charges. |
| Idle databases | Stop or delete databases that are no longer needed. Remember that stopped RDS instances automatically restart after 7 consecutive days, and storage, backup storage, and Provisioned IOPS charges continue while stopped. |
| Public IPv4 addresses | Publicly accessible RDS instances may incur standard public IPv4 charges. Verify that a public IP is required. |
| Monitoring features | Review optional services such as RDS Proxy, Enhanced Monitoring, and Performance Insights to ensure they still provide value. |
Should You Consider Reserved DB Instances or Database Savings Plans?
- Reserved DB Instances are suited to stable, predictable RDS deployments and apply to specific DB instance attributes.
- AWS Database Savings Plans provide a flexible, usage-based commitment that applies across eligible database services, including eligible Amazon RDS usage, without requiring you to reserve a specific DB instance configuration.
Before purchasing any commitment, review your database utilization and expected growth to ensure the commitment matches your long-term usage patterns.

Frequently asked questions
Is Amazon RDS free forever?
No. Amazon RDS is not a permanently free service. Eligible AWS customers receive Free Tier benefits for a limited period or promotional AWS credits, depending on when their AWS account was created. Once your Free Tier benefits expire or your promotional credits are exhausted, Amazon RDS usage is billed at the standard on-demand rates.
Does the Amazon RDS Free Tier include Amazon Aurora?
No. Amazon Aurora has a separate pricing model and is not included in the traditional Amazon RDS Free Tier. If you deploy an Aurora cluster, you should expect charges based on Aurora compute, storage, and other applicable pricing components.
What database engines are supported under the Amazon RDS Free Tier?
The traditional Amazon RDS Free Tier supports eligible configurations for MySQL, PostgreSQL, MariaDB, and Microsoft SQL Server Express Edition. Eligibility depends on the database engine, edition, licensing model, and deployment configuration.
What happens if I exceed the Amazon RDS Free Tier limits?
If your database exceeds the applicable Free Tier limits, the additional usage is billed at the standard Amazon RDS on-demand rates.
Common reasons include running multiple database instances, exceeding the included storage or backup allocation, enabling Multi-AZ deployments, or using features that are not covered by the Free Tier.
How can I monitor my Amazon RDS costs?
AWS provides several tools to help monitor Amazon RDS spending, including AWS Cost Explorer, AWS Billing and Cost Management, and AWS Budgets. Reviewing these regularly allows you to track database usage, identify cost trends, and receive alerts before charges increase unexpectedly.
AWS Budgets and AWS Cost Anomaly Detection can also help notify you when Amazon RDS spending exceeds expected levels.
